This Demonstration shows how to graphically determine the intersection of two lines given by equations. Draw points and
that satisfy the first equation and draw a line through them, then do the same with points
and
for the second equation. Let
be the intersection of the lines. Use Alt+Click (Cmd+Click on Mac) to draw a new point. Drag the corner points to move the lines through them.
